How to Get Rid of Cat Scratch Scars

Cat scratch scars often appear as linear marks resulting from superficial trauma that extends into the dermis. The body’s natural healing process sometimes leads to an overproduction of collagen, which can result in a raised, discolored, or noticeable scar. While it is not possible to fully erase a scar, various methods exist to significantly reduce its appearance, making it blend more seamlessly with the surrounding skin. The approach to scar reduction depends heavily on the scar’s age, its characteristics, and the individual’s skin type.

Immediate First Aid to Minimize Scarring

Minimizing the final appearance of a cat scratch begins immediately after the injury, focusing on proper acute wound care to prevent infection and promote optimal healing. The first step involves thoroughly cleaning the wound gently with mild soap and running water for several minutes. This helps to flush out any foreign matter, reducing the risk of infection.

After cleaning, apply an over-the-counter antibiotic ointment or a non-harsh antiseptic to protect the area. The wound should then be covered with a sterile bandage or dressing. Maintaining a moist environment is beneficial for healing and discourages the formation of a hard scab that can lead to a more prominent scar. The dressing should be changed daily or whenever it becomes wet or dirty.

Treating Established Scars with Over-the-Counter Products

Once the skin has fully closed and the initial wound has healed, topical non-prescription products can be used to influence the scar maturation process. Silicone is the most widely recommended first-line therapy for hypertrophic (raised) and keloid scars due to its proven efficacy. Silicone products, available as sheets or gels, work by creating an occlusive barrier over the skin.

This barrier reduces transepidermal water loss (TEWL), which increases the hydration of the stratum corneum. Increased hydration helps normalize the activity of fibroblasts, the cells responsible for collagen production. This leads to a softer, flatter, and less red scar.

Silicone sheets should ideally be worn for 12 to 24 hours per day for several months. Silicone gels offer a more convenient and less visible option for areas like the face.

Another common topical ingredient is onion bulb extract, often combined with allantoin and heparin in scar treatment gels. This extract possesses anti-inflammatory and antiproliferative properties, which help inhibit the excessive growth of scar tissue. Onion extract is noted for its potential to improve the color and redness of scars, though it may be less effective than silicone in reducing scar height.

Massaging the established scar tissue is a simple mechanical technique performed alongside topical treatments. Applying firm, circular pressure for a few minutes multiple times a day helps to physically break down the dense, disorganized collagen fibers. This action improves the pliability and texture of the scar, encouraging the collagen to rearrange into a flatter, more flexible pattern.

Advanced and Professional Scar Reduction Techniques

When over-the-counter methods do not provide sufficient improvement, clinical interventions offered by dermatologists or plastic surgeons present more powerful options. For raised, thick scars, intralesional corticosteroid injections are a standard treatment. These injections deliver an anti-inflammatory medication, typically triamcinolone, directly into the scar tissue to inhibit the overproduction of collagen, causing the scar to flatten over time.

Laser treatments are highly effective for addressing specific scar characteristics, such as color and texture irregularities. Pulsed dye lasers (PDL) target blood vessels within the scar, reducing the redness common in new or active scars. Fractional lasers create microscopic controlled injuries in the skin, stimulating a wound-healing response that encourages the production of new, healthier collagen to replace the scarred tissue.

Microneedling, also known as collagen induction therapy, uses a device with fine needles to create controlled micro-injuries on the skin surface. This process initiates the body’s natural healing cascade, which remodels the existing scar tissue and induces the formation of new, more organized collagen and elastin. Microneedling can be beneficial for scars that are slightly depressed or have an irregular texture.

In rare instances where a scar does not respond to less invasive methods, surgical scar revision may be considered. This procedure involves excising the old scar and carefully closing the wound with meticulous suturing techniques to create a new, less noticeable linear scar. Often, a combination of professional techniques, such as laser treatment followed by topical application of corticosteroids, yields the most comprehensive improvement.
